The School For Good Mothers, Book Club Questions

A Book Club is always a good way to bond with those people who share your love of books, but occasionally the group needs a little prompting on discussion topics to get the conversation flowing. Please find below a few ideas to get things started.

  1. What were you expecting from the book to start with? Did the book meet your expectations? If not, what was different?
  2. The book starts with Frida leaving her child at home – how did you feel about her as a mother then? Did that change over the book?
  3. What were your thoughts about the ‘robot children’ and the way they were used to measure parenting?
  4. How do you feel about the relationship between Frida, Gust and Susanna? How did that change throughout the book?
  5. What did you feel while you were reading this book? When? Why?
  6. Which of the standards set down by the school were reasonable in your eyes? Which were not?
  7. Would you re-read this book? Why? When?
  8. What were your feelings on the difference between the mothers school and the fathers school? Why were those differences important?
  9. Frida is the only chinese american in the school – how does this impact her? How is race discussed in the book?
  10. How do you feel about Emmanuelle being packed away ready for the next mother?
  11. How do you think this would translate into a film?
  12. Would you recommend this to any friends? Who? Why?
